Detailed Solution

Phasor diagrams:

In L-C branch, the phase angle between total voltage and current is 90°.

Question Image

In the branch with only resistor, voltage and current are in phase. 

Question Image

As the L-C branch and the R branch are in parallel, the voltage across both branches is same and the currents through both branches have 90° phase angle between them.

Question Image

Therefore, current through source I=I12+I22.

Here, maximum current through L-C branch, I1=VXLXC=200200100=2 A,

and the maximum current through R branch, I2=VR=200100=2 A.

Total maximum  current through source, I=22+22=22 A.

  P=2.
